About the Business Data Analyst - Capital Market role

A Business Data Analyst specializing in Capital Market jobs plays a pivotal role at the intersection of finance, technology, and data analytics. These professionals are responsible for bridging the gap between complex financial trading operations and the technical systems that support them. In the fast-paced world of capital markets, where split-second decisions can have significant financial impact, the Business Data Analyst ensures that data flows accurately, efficiently, and securely across trading floors, risk management departments, and back-office functions.

Typical responsibilities for this role encompass a wide range of strategic and operational tasks. Analysts define and document detailed business requirements for market data infrastructure, ensuring systems maintain high availability and minimal downtime—a critical requirement in trading environments. They provide architectural guidance for implementing data platforms that handle real-time feeds from exchanges and financial data providers. A significant part of the job involves analyzing and configuring market data platforms to ensure optimal performance, reliability, and cost efficiency. These professionals also manage stakeholder relationships, translating business needs into technical specifications for development teams. They oversee system documentation, improve incident management governance, and define comprehensive monitoring matrices to preemptively identify issues. Additionally, they often coordinate the migration of legacy on-premise systems to modern managed services or cloud-based solutions, ensuring seamless transitions without disrupting trading activities.

To succeed in these jobs, a Business Data Analyst must possess a unique blend of skills. Deep knowledge of financial market data systems and content is essential, including familiarity with leading platforms and distribution technologies. Technical expertise is equally important, covering areas such as automated software distribution, workstation build technologies, and networking principles. The ability to quickly diagnose and resolve issues in a high-pressure trading room environment is a hallmark of a strong candidate. Soft skills are just as critical: exceptional communication, project planning, and time management abilities are necessary to coordinate with diverse global teams and stakeholders. Experience working within Agile or Scrum frameworks is commonly expected, as is proficiency with incident and task management tools.
